Everyone knows having great home insurance is essential in case of a ice storm, hailstorm or blizzard. But homeowners insurance is about more than covering natural disaster damage. An additional feature of home insurance is its ability to protect you in certain legal situations. If someone slips because of negligence on your part, you could be held responsible for their hospital bills or physical therapy. With good home coverage, your insurance may cover those costs.
